Termografia e ultra-sonografia no diagnóstico de lesões toracolombares em eqüinos atletas da raça Quarto de Milha /

Fonseca, Brunna Patrícia Almeida da. January 2005 (has links)
Orientador: Ana Liz Garcia Alves / Banca: José Luiz de Mello Nicoletti / Banca: Raquel Yvonne Arantes Baccarin / Resumo: O objetivo deste estudo foi avaliar a eficácia da termografia e ultra-sonografia no diagnóstico das lesões toracolombares em eqüinos atletas da raça Quarto de Milha e associar os diferentes tipos de lesões à modalidade atlética desenvolvida. Foram utilizados 24 animais admitidos no Serviço de Cirurgia de Grandes Animais da Faculdade de Medicina Veterinária e Zootecnia - UNESP - Botucatu com queixa de lombalgia. Estes animais foram submetidos a exame físico para confirmar a existência de alteração toracolombar e então aos exames termográfico e ultra-sonográfico. O exame termográfico foi utilizado para o mapeamento das áreas lesadas da região e a ultra-sonografia para a caracterização das lesões. As lesões encontradas foram a desmite supraespinhosa, desmite interespinhosa, osteoartrite intervertebral dorsal e síndrome dos processos espinhosos ("kissing spines"). Foi constatada a existência de relação entre o tipo de atividade exercida pelo animal com o tipo de lesão encontrado. Nos animais que desempenhavam prova dos três tambores houve um predomínio de lesões na região torácica caudal, toracolombar e lombar cranial, sendo a osteoartrite intervertebral e a desmite interespinhosa as afecções mais encontradas. Nos animais de apartação observou-se a maioria das lesões na região lombar caudal, sendo predominantes a osteoartrite intervertebral e a desmite supraespinhosa. Já nos animais de rédeas o local preferencial de lesão foi a região média lombar, com predomínio de osteoartrites intervertebrais, desmites supraespinhosas e miosites. A termografia associada à ultra-sonografia se mostraram eficientes no diagnóstico das lesões toracolombares destes eqüinos. / Abstract: The objective of this study was to appreciate the efficacy of thermography and ultrassonography for toracolombar lesions diagnostic in athletic American Quarter Horse and associate this to the different kinds of athletic modalities. Was used 24 animals accepted in Cirurgia de Grandes Animais service of the Faculdade de Medicina Veterinária e Zootecnia - UNESP - Botucatu with lombalgy report. Those animals was submitted to a physical exam to confirm the toracolombar pain existence and so, to the thermographic and ultrassonographic exams. The thermographic exam was performed for mapping the lesioned areas and the ultrassonographic exam, for the characterization of this lesions. After the exams, supraspinal desmitis, interspinal desmitis, dorsal invertebral osteoarthritis and spinous processes impingement (kissing spines) was found. The relation between the modality of athletic activity performed by the animal and the type of lesion ranged was verify. The barrel race horses presents prevalence of lesions in thoracic caudal, toracolombar and lumbar cranial regions and the invertebral osteoarthritis and interspinal desmitis was the prevalence on affections. In cutting horses, was verify that the major part of lesions was localized on caudal lumbar region with the prevalence of invertebral osteoartrite and supraspinal desmitis. In reining animals the prevalence of lesions was in medial lombar region, where invertebral osteoartrite, supraspinal desmitis and miositis was verify with constancy. The thermography in association with ultrassonography shows efficacy in toracolombar injuries diagnoses for this horses. / Mestre

Voltage loss analysis of PEM fuel cells

Jayasankar, B., Pohlmann, C., Harvey, D.B. 25 November 2019 (has links)
The assessment of performance for PEM Fuel Cells (PEMFC) at the stack, Single Repeating Unit (SRU), and Membrane Electrode Assembly (MEA) level is dominated by the evaluation of polarization curves. However, polarization curves do not provide adequate detail as to the origin of the inefficiencies of the fuel cell performance and information on these sources of origin are critical to understand and address topics such as material selection, optimal operating conditions, and overall robust and reliable cell and stack design characteristics. To the purpose of understanding the origin of the inefficiencies underlying the fuel cell polarization curve a series of additional experimental and analysis techniques must be applied and from the resultant data the origin of the inefficiencies can then be assigned to kinetic, ohmic, and mass transport loss categorizations. Further, through a combination of the diagnostic methods further resolution can be implied down to the contribution of the individual components to the relative voltage loss categories. In this topic, a methodology will be presented and discussed that achieves and demonstrates this process.
